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Malbuisson to Paris is to bus which costs €35 - €70 and takes 10h 5m.
The fastest way to get from Malbuisson to Paris is to drive which takes 4h 49m and costs €65 - €100.
No, there is no direct bus from Malbuisson to Paris station. However, there are services departing from Malbuisson and arriving at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station via Frasne and Pontarlier - Bus station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 10h 5m.
The distance between Malbuisson and Paris is 445 km. The road distance is 446.2 km.
The best way to get from Malbuisson to Paris without a car is to train which takes 5h 20m and costs €80 - €160.
It takes approximately 5h 20m to get from Malbuisson to Paris, including transfers.
Malbuisson to Paris bus services, operated by BlaBlaCar Bus, depart from Pontarlier - Bus station.
The best way to get from Malbuisson to Paris is to train which takes 5h 20m and costs €80 - €160.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s €35 - €70 and takes 10h 5m.
Malbuisson to Paris bus services, operated by BlaBlaCar Bus, arrive at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Malbuisson to Paris is 446 km. It takes approximately 4h 49m to drive from Malbuisson to Paris.
What companies run services between Malbuisson, Bourgogne-Franche-Comté, France and Paris, France?
TGV inOui operates a train from Vallorbe to Paris Gare De Lyon once daily. Tickets cost €80–140 and the journey takes 3h 5m. Alternatively, BlaBlaCar Bus operates a bus from Pontarlier - Bus station to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station twice daily. Tickets cost €29–55 and the journey takes 7h 15m.
